Output 35dc10066afd3a856cd69ddf1e970bd98fc47e8d23df39cf6f4f7d871d6fdd5c:0

value
168560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c8759d0fd6b98788f7a55d575908214f9f0c7b3 OP_EQUAL
address
3A8GEXumhPpzCznukf4SQMawNCA3bfRki7
transaction
35dc10066afd3a856cd69ddf1e970bd98fc47e8d23df39cf6f4f7d871d6fdd5c
confirmations
50669
spent
true